☐ Give the newbie the tour of the spare hardware store — that's room B14 behind the Cortwell print hub. Facilities desk owns the stock list, so show them the laminated sheet on the inside of the door and explain the golden rule: anything taken out gets logged, no exceptions, or Henrik will grumble for a week. Monitors and dock stations live on the left racks, cables in the labelled bins. The door runs on a keypad rather than badge tap, so they'll need the code, which is below.

door code, yagap-bahof: bdg-O-05

Q3 Planning Note — Board Only

Varrow Logistics delivered a revised term sheet Tuesday. Valuation unchanged; liquidation preference cut to 1x non-participating. Board seat demand dropped in exchange for observer rights. Counsel at Hale & Brigg flagged the exclusivity clause as aggressive — 90 days. Recommend we counter at 45 and sign by month-end. Details of our position follow below.

internal memo for kawip-hadug: Headcount on the Wenwyn team goes from 7 to 140 by the end of January. Gross margin on Wenwyn came in at 20 percent against a plan of 15 percent.

## Changelog — Ledgerloom 4.2.0

### Changed defaults

The inventory reconciliation job now runs every four hours instead of nightly, and mismatch tolerance dropped from 2% to 0.5%. Partial-batch retries are enabled by default, and stale warehouse snapshots older than six hours are skipped rather than flagged. If you are onboarding, note that older runbooks still describe the nightly cadence; ignore them. No action is needed unless you overrode prior defaults. The new default configuration values are listed below.

settings of bawif-fawif:
ralix:
  log_level: warn
  metrics_host: metrics.ralix.tolvaqsys.internal
  pool_size: 32

**Vendor note: Inkmill markdown pipeline**

Rendering for Parchway docs is outsourced to Inkmill under an annual contract, renewing each March. They handle sanitization and PDF export; we own the upload queue. SLA: 4-hour response on rendering failures. Escalate only after two failed retries. Their support desk is reachable at the address below.

billing contact of hahaf-baguf = zorael.tammir.jorius@sivrelhq.internal